Kamchuwa, 18 January 2011 – The inhabitants of Kamchuwa administrative area said that the newly opened health center in the area is rendering commendable medical service to the public.
They further commended the initiatives taken in tackling lack of enough rooms and manpower in the center, and stated that such problems are now no more.
The local inhabitants said that the provision of accessible health service in their respective areas has significant role to play in reducing mother and child mortality rate. More pregnant mothers are also giving birth at the health center.
Reports indicated that the awareness of the society as regards the significance of modern medicine continues to grow, and that commendable change is being witnessed in controlling diseases.
